There are three … WebDec 6, 2024 · Many important items in life (traffic lights, stop signs) have workarounds for color blind people. If you can’t tell the difference between red and green, traffic lights are always in the same order (red light on top, green light on the bottom). Yes, stop signs are red, but they’re also all the same distinct shape.
